| /dpdk/lib/hash/ |
| H A D | rte_thash.h | 73 uint32_t src_addr; member 91 uint8_t src_addr[16]; member 143 __m128i ipv6 = _mm_loadu_si128((const __m128i *)orig->src_addr); in rte_thash_load_v6_addrs() 144 *(__m128i *)targ->v6.src_addr = in rte_thash_load_v6_addrs() 150 uint8x16_t ipv6 = vld1q_u8((uint8_t const *)orig->src_addr); in rte_thash_load_v6_addrs() 151 vst1q_u8((uint8_t *)targ->v6.src_addr, vrev32q_u8(ipv6)); in rte_thash_load_v6_addrs() 157 *((uint32_t *)targ->v6.src_addr + i) = in rte_thash_load_v6_addrs() 158 rte_be_to_cpu_32(*((const uint32_t *)orig->src_addr + i)); in rte_thash_load_v6_addrs()
|
| /dpdk/app/test-pmd/ |
| H A D | icmpecho.c | 321 ether_addr_dump(" ETH: src=", ð_h->src_addr); in reply_to_icmp_echo_rqsts() 387 rte_ether_addr_copy(ð_h->src_addr, ð_h->dst_addr); in reply_to_icmp_echo_rqsts() 390 ð_h->src_addr); in reply_to_icmp_echo_rqsts() 397 rte_ether_addr_copy(ð_h->src_addr, in reply_to_icmp_echo_rqsts() 414 ipv4_addr_dump(" IPV4: src=", ip_h->src_addr); in reply_to_icmp_echo_rqsts() 455 rte_ether_addr_copy(ð_h->src_addr, ð_addr); in reply_to_icmp_echo_rqsts() 456 rte_ether_addr_copy(ð_h->dst_addr, ð_h->src_addr); in reply_to_icmp_echo_rqsts() 458 ip_addr = ip_h->src_addr; in reply_to_icmp_echo_rqsts() 467 ip_h->src_addr = rte_cpu_to_be_32(ip_src); in reply_to_icmp_echo_rqsts() 471 ip_h->src_addr = ip_h->dst_addr; in reply_to_icmp_echo_rqsts()
|
| H A D | 5tswap.c | 31 rte_ether_addr_copy(ð_hdr->src_addr, ð_hdr->dst_addr); in swap_mac() 32 rte_ether_addr_copy(&addr, ð_hdr->src_addr); in swap_mac() 41 addr = ipv4_hdr->src_addr; in swap_ipv4() 42 ipv4_hdr->src_addr = ipv4_hdr->dst_addr; in swap_ipv4() 52 memcpy(&addr, &ipv6_hdr->src_addr, 16); in swap_ipv6() 53 memcpy(&ipv6_hdr->src_addr, &ipv6_hdr->dst_addr, 16); in swap_ipv6()
|
| H A D | macswap.h | 33 rte_ether_addr_copy(ð_hdr->src_addr, ð_hdr->dst_addr); in do_macswap() 34 rte_ether_addr_copy(&addr, ð_hdr->src_addr); in do_macswap()
|
| /dpdk/app/test/ |
| H A D | test_acl.h | 85 .src_addr = RTE_IPV4(10,0,0,0), 180 .src_addr = RTE_IPV4(10,0,0,0), 191 .src_addr = RTE_IPV4(10,1,1,0), 202 .src_addr = RTE_IPV4(10,1,1,1), 398 .src_addr = RTE_IPV4(5,6,7,8), 416 .src_addr = RTE_IPV4(1,2,3,4), 434 .src_addr = RTE_IPV4(5,6,7,8), 450 .src_addr = RTE_IPV4(1,2,3,4), 680 .src_addr = RTE_IPV4(0, 0, 0, 1), 689 .src_addr = RTE_IPV4(0, 4, 3, 2), [all …]
|
| H A D | packet_burst_generator.c | 61 rte_ether_addr_copy(src_mac, ð_hdr->src_addr); in initialize_eth_header() 143 initialize_ipv6_header(struct rte_ipv6_hdr *ip_hdr, uint8_t *src_addr, in initialize_ipv6_header() argument 151 rte_memcpy(ip_hdr->src_addr, src_addr, sizeof(ip_hdr->src_addr)); in initialize_ipv6_header() 158 initialize_ipv4_header(struct rte_ipv4_hdr *ip_hdr, uint32_t src_addr, in initialize_ipv4_header() argument 177 ip_hdr->src_addr = rte_cpu_to_be_32(src_addr); in initialize_ipv4_header() 206 initialize_ipv4_header_proto(struct rte_ipv4_hdr *ip_hdr, uint32_t src_addr, in initialize_ipv4_header_proto() argument 225 ip_hdr->src_addr = rte_cpu_to_be_32(src_addr); in initialize_ipv4_header_proto()
|
| H A D | packet_burst_generator.h | 50 initialize_ipv6_header(struct rte_ipv6_hdr *ip_hdr, uint8_t *src_addr, 54 initialize_ipv4_header(struct rte_ipv4_hdr *ip_hdr, uint32_t src_addr, 58 initialize_ipv4_header_proto(struct rte_ipv4_hdr *ip_hdr, uint32_t src_addr,
|
| H A D | test_thash.c | 125 tuple.v4.src_addr = v4_tbl[i].src_ip; in test_toeplitz_hash_calc() 148 for (j = 0; j < RTE_DIM(ipv6_hdr.src_addr); j++) in test_toeplitz_hash_calc() 149 ipv6_hdr.src_addr[j] = v6_tbl[i].src_ip[j]; in test_toeplitz_hash_calc() 192 tuple.v4.src_addr = rte_cpu_to_be_32(v4_tbl[i].src_ip); in test_toeplitz_hash_gfni() 207 for (j = 0; j < RTE_DIM(tuple.v6.src_addr); j++) in test_toeplitz_hash_gfni() 208 tuple.v6.src_addr[j] = v6_tbl[i].src_ip[j]; in test_toeplitz_hash_gfni() 324 tuple[0].v4.src_addr = rte_cpu_to_be_32(v4_tbl[i].src_ip); in test_toeplitz_hash_gfni_bulk() 331 for (j = 0; j < RTE_DIM(tuple[1].v6.src_addr); j++) in test_toeplitz_hash_gfni_bulk() 332 tuple[1].v6.src_addr[j] = v6_tbl[i].src_ip[j]; in test_toeplitz_hash_gfni_bulk() 603 tuple.v4.src_addr = RTE_IPV4(0, 0, 0, 0); in test_predictable_rss_min_seq()
|
| H A D | test_flow_classify.c | 64 offsetof(struct rte_ipv4_hdr, src_addr), 115 .src_addr = 0xffffff00, 480 uint32_t src_addr = IPV4_ADDR(2, 2, 2, 3); in init_ipv4_udp_traffic() local 496 pktlen = initialize_ipv4_header(&pkt_ipv4_hdr, src_addr, dst_addr, in init_ipv4_udp_traffic() 517 uint32_t src_addr = IPV4_ADDR(1, 2, 3, 4); in init_ipv4_tcp_traffic() local 533 pktlen = initialize_ipv4_header_proto(&pkt_ipv4_hdr, src_addr, in init_ipv4_tcp_traffic() 554 uint32_t src_addr = IPV4_ADDR(11, 12, 13, 14); in init_ipv4_sctp_traffic() local 570 pktlen = initialize_ipv4_header_proto(&pkt_ipv4_hdr, src_addr, in init_ipv4_sctp_traffic()
|
| H A D | test_ipfrag.c | 143 hdr->src_addr = rte_cpu_to_be_32(0x8080808); in v4_allocate_packet_of() 167 memset(hdr->src_addr, 0x08, sizeof(hdr->src_addr)); in v6_allocate_packet_of() 168 memset(hdr->dst_addr, 0x04, sizeof(hdr->src_addr)); in v6_allocate_packet_of()
|
| /dpdk/examples/ipsec-secgw/ |
| H A D | flow.c | 42 uint32_t_to_char(rte_bswap32(hdr->src_addr), &a, &b, &c, &d); in ipv4_hdr_print() 64 memcpy(mask, &rte_flow_item_ipv4_mask.hdr.src_addr, sizeof(ip)); in ipv4_addr_cpy() 78 addr = hdr->src_addr; in ipv6_hdr_print() 113 memcpy(mask, &rte_flow_item_ipv6_mask.hdr.src_addr, sizeof(ip)); in ipv6_addr_cpy() 153 if (ipv4_addr_cpy(&rule->ipv4.spec.hdr.src_addr, in parse_flow_tokens() 154 &rule->ipv4.mask.hdr.src_addr, in parse_flow_tokens() 158 if (ipv6_addr_cpy(rule->ipv6.spec.hdr.src_addr, in parse_flow_tokens() 159 rule->ipv6.mask.hdr.src_addr, in parse_flow_tokens()
|
| H A D | sad.h | 36 (sa->src.ip.ip4 == ipv4->src_addr) && in cmp_sa_key() 40 (!memcmp(sa->src.ip.ip6.ip6, ipv6->src_addr, 16)) && in cmp_sa_key() 117 v4[nb_v4].sip = ipv4->src_addr; in sad_lookup() 133 memcpy(v6[nb_v6].sip, ipv6->src_addr, in sad_lookup() 134 sizeof(ipv6->src_addr)); in sad_lookup()
|
| /dpdk/examples/pipeline/examples/ |
| H A D | registers.spec | 17 bit<48> src_addr 30 bit<32> src_addr 60 regadd pkt_counters h.ipv4.src_addr 1 61 regadd byte_counters h.ipv4.src_addr h.ipv4.total_len
|
| H A D | l2fwd_macswp.spec | 9 bit<48> src_addr 30 mov h.ethernet.dst_addr h.ethernet.src_addr 31 mov h.ethernet.src_addr m.addr
|
| H A D | meter.spec | 17 bit<48> src_addr 30 bit<32> src_addr 59 meter meters h.ipv4.src_addr h.ipv4.total_len 0 m.port_out
|
| H A D | fib.spec | 31 bit<48> src_addr 44 bit<32> src_addr 87 mov h.ethernet.src_addr t.ethernet_src_addr 130 h.ipv4.src_addr 163 mov m.vrf_id h.ipv4.src_addr
|
| /dpdk/drivers/crypto/ccp/ |
| H A D | ccp_crypto.c | 1654 pst.src_addr = in ccp_perform_hmac() 1762 phys_addr_t src_addr, dest_addr; in ccp_perform_sha() local 1777 pst.src_addr = (phys_addr_t)sha_ctx; in ccp_perform_sha() 1919 pst.src_addr = in ccp_perform_sha3_hmac() 2077 phys_addr_t src_addr, dest_addr, key_addr; in ccp_perform_aes_cmac() local 2240 phys_addr_t src_addr, dest_addr, key_addr; in ccp_perform_aes() local 2261 pst.src_addr = b_info->lsb_buf_phys + in ccp_perform_aes() 2282 dest_addr = src_addr; in ccp_perform_aes() 2329 phys_addr_t src_addr, dest_addr, key_addr; in ccp_perform_3des() local 2369 dest_addr = src_addr; in ccp_perform_3des() [all …]
|
| /dpdk/lib/net/ |
| H A D | rte_ip.h | 62 rte_be32_t src_addr; /**< source address */ member 325 uint32_t src_addr; /* IP address of source host. */ in rte_ipv4_phdr_cksum() member 334 psd_hdr.src_addr = ipv4_hdr->src_addr; in rte_ipv4_phdr_cksum() 528 uint8_t src_addr[16]; /**< IP address of source host. */ member 575 sum = __rte_raw_cksum(ipv6_hdr->src_addr, in rte_ipv6_phdr_cksum() 576 sizeof(ipv6_hdr->src_addr) + sizeof(ipv6_hdr->dst_addr), in rte_ipv6_phdr_cksum()
|
| /dpdk/drivers/net/tap/ |
| H A D | tap_bpf_program.c | 74 __u32 src_addr; member 81 __u8 src_addr[16]; member 160 .src_addr = IPv4(*(src_dst_addr + 0), in rss_l3_l4() 187 *((uint32_t *)&v6_tuple.src_addr + j) = in rss_l3_l4()
|
| /dpdk/drivers/dma/ioat/ |
| H A D | ioat_hw_defs.h | 131 uint64_t src_addr; member 187 uint64_t src_addr; member 226 uint64_t src_addr; member 267 uint64_t src_addr; member
|
| /dpdk/drivers/net/qede/base/ |
| H A D | ecore_hw.c | 745 u64 src_addr, in ecore_dmae_execute_sub_operation() argument 764 (void *)(osal_uintptr_t)src_addr, in ecore_dmae_execute_sub_operation() 810 (unsigned long)src_addr, (unsigned long)dst_addr, in ecore_dmae_execute_sub_operation() 827 u64 src_addr, in ecore_dmae_execute_command() argument 845 (unsigned long)src_addr, src_type, in ecore_dmae_execute_command() 854 (unsigned long)src_addr, src_type, in ecore_dmae_execute_command() 866 (unsigned long)src_addr, in ecore_dmae_execute_command() 884 src_addr_split = src_addr; in ecore_dmae_execute_command() 892 src_addr_split = src_addr + offset; in ecore_dmae_execute_command() 894 src_addr_split = src_addr + (offset * 4); in ecore_dmae_execute_command() [all …]
|
| /dpdk/drivers/common/cnxk/ |
| H A D | cnxk_security.c | 279 memcpy(&sa->outer_hdr.ipv4.src_addr, &tunnel->ipv4.src_ip, in ot_ipsec_inb_tunnel_hdr_fill() 285 sa->outer_hdr.ipv4.src_addr = in ot_ipsec_inb_tunnel_hdr_fill() 286 rte_be_to_cpu_32(sa->outer_hdr.ipv4.src_addr); in ot_ipsec_inb_tunnel_hdr_fill() 293 memcpy(&sa->outer_hdr.ipv6.src_addr, &tunnel->ipv6.src_addr, in ot_ipsec_inb_tunnel_hdr_fill() 451 memcpy(&sa->outer_hdr.ipv4.src_addr, &tunnel->ipv4.src_ip, in cnxk_ot_ipsec_outb_sa_fill() 457 sa->outer_hdr.ipv4.src_addr = in cnxk_ot_ipsec_outb_sa_fill() 458 rte_be_to_cpu_32(sa->outer_hdr.ipv4.src_addr); in cnxk_ot_ipsec_outb_sa_fill() 482 memcpy(&sa->outer_hdr.ipv6.src_addr, &tunnel->ipv6.src_addr, in cnxk_ot_ipsec_outb_sa_fill()
|
| /dpdk/drivers/raw/ioat/ |
| H A D | ioat_spec.h | 110 uint64_t src_addr; member 166 uint64_t src_addr; member 205 uint64_t src_addr; member 246 uint64_t src_addr; member
|
| /dpdk/drivers/net/ice/base/ |
| H A D | ice_protocol_type.h | 237 u8 src_addr[ETH_ALEN]; member 246 u8 src_addr[ETH_ALEN]; member 264 __be32 src_addr; member 284 u8 src_addr[ICE_IPV6_ADDR_LENGTH]; member
|
| /dpdk/examples/flow_filtering/ |
| H A D | flow_blocks.c | 93 ip_spec.hdr.src_addr = htonl(src_ip); in generate_ipv4_flow() 94 ip_mask.hdr.src_addr = src_mask; in generate_ipv4_flow()
|